Filling the airwaves with love and soon will run high on the movie screen! Forevermore, the classic hit of Side A is now a movie. Forevermore will star Jericho Rosales and Kristine Hermosa, neo of the hottest loveteams and youngest actors of local cinema!
Composed by Joey Benin and released by Warner Music Philippines in 1995, Forevermore has not only become one of the many hits of Side A, it launched the band to prominence, and remained one of the most sought after performing artists in local musicdom today. With its theme close to the heart, catchy lyrics and melody that charms, Forevermore is more than just a famous song. It delves deep within the happiness a lonesome person feels when someone he met or just came a crossed with unpredictably or invariably becomes the person he is actually looking for emotionally. It comes off as the perfect tune of romance and thanking the world and beyond for having who you honestly fell for emotionally come into your life. One of the original songs of the OPM arena, Forevermore has become a certified nine time platinum hit of Side A.
Now metamorphosing into a sweet, colorful and very romantic movie released by Star Cinema, John-D Lazatin directs a story in a screenplay by Mari Lamasan and Henry Quitain, where love and belief in legend and tradition move as one. Forevermore is a story of two very young hearts that became estranged only to meet again with different outlooks in life now. In the course of their second meeting, they re-discover new facets about each other and of themselves. In the course of their new togetherness, what they are actually fulfilling is a legend bestowed on the land where they first met. That only love can make and help a place prosper and bear fruit.
Forevermore also stars John Lloyd Cruz, Michelle Bayle, Caridad Sanchez, Luz Valdez, John Arcilla Justin Cuyugan and Nestor de Villa, with the special participation of Dominic Ochoa.
Forevermore is also one of the tracks in the original soundtrack of Forevermore, recorded by Jericho Rosales and Kristine Hermosa.
Another much anticipated sweet and romantic treat of the year, Forevermore opens in June 26, 2002!
